Abstract
The effect of niobium on the extent of columnar growth of grains and on the magnetic properties in Alnico alloys has been studied. Alloys containing 1 % Nb show maximum growth of columnar crystals. In columnar alloys, coercivity increases slowly with increasing niobium content up to ∼ 1 %. With further increase in niobium, coercivity and remanence decrease. The maximum energy product (55 kJ m−3) has been obtained at 1 % Nb. Niobium addition has also been found to suppress the precipitation of the undesirable γ phase.
